Why Golf and Pickleball Are Growing Together
Golf and pickleball may appear to be very different.
Golf is played across a large outdoor course and rewards patience, distance control and strategic decision-making. Pickleball is played on a compact court with short rallies, frequent interaction and quick changes between games.
Yet both sports share several characteristics:
- Players can begin without needing elite athletic ability
- Technique and decision-making matter as much as power
- Social interaction is built into the experience
- Doubles, leagues and group formats encourage connection
- Players can continue improving over many years
- Recreational and competitive participation can exist together
Both sports are also attracting substantial participation.
The National Golf Foundation reported that 48.1 million Americans played golf either on a course or through off-course golf activities in 2025. That included 29.1 million on-course golfers.
USA Pickleball reported an estimated 24.3 million participants and identified 2025 as the fourth consecutive year in which pickleball remained America’s fastest-growing sport.
These numbers suggest that many people are not choosing between traditional and emerging sports. They are building more varied recreational routines.
A multi-sport facility gives them room to do both.
1. Golf and Pickleball Create Different Social Rhythms
One reason the two sports work well together is that they support different kinds of interaction.
Golf Creates Time for Longer Conversations
A golf round unfolds gradually.
Players walk or ride between shots, discuss decisions, celebrate good holes and spend several hours together without needing a formal agenda.
That makes golf useful for:
- Reconnecting with friends
- Spending time with family
- Meeting other local players
- Entertaining clients
- Building professional relationships
- Organizing charity or corporate outings
The game creates natural pauses for conversation while still giving the group a shared activity.
Pickleball Creates Faster Social Rotation
Pickleball matches are generally shorter and take place in a smaller shared area.
Players can rotate partners, join open-play sessions and meet several people during one visit. Spectators and waiting players also remain close to the action instead of being spread across a large course.
At Northdale’s Pickle Social Lounge, daily open play, weekly leagues, tournaments and social events give players multiple ways to join the community rather than relying only on private court bookings.
Golf builds connection over distance and time. Pickleball creates it through energy and rotation.
Together, they give guests more control over how they want to socialize.

6. Golf Remains the Strategic Center of the Experience
Adding pickleball does not mean golf becomes less important.
At Northdale, golf remains a major part of the club’s identity.
The public 18-hole, par-72 layout was designed by Ron Garl and moves through ponds, mature oaks and rolling fairways. Four tee boxes help players select a distance appropriate for their ability, while the practice green, cart rentals and pro-shop essentials support regular play.
No golf membership is required, which makes the course accessible to:
- Local golfers
- Tampa visitors
- Beginners
- Experienced players
- League participants
- Corporate groups
- Charity outings
- Players seeking weekday or twilight rounds
This public-access model is important to the broader social-hub concept.
People can participate without first entering a long-term private-club commitment. They can book a round, attend an event, join a league or visit the restaurant based on their current needs.

8. Leagues Turn Occasional Visitors Into a Community
A one-time reservation introduces someone to a facility.
A recurring league gives them a reason to return.
Leagues create structure without requiring every participant to organize a new group each week. Players begin recognizing one another, tracking progress and building routines around regular play.
Northdale currently promotes recurring golf formats including weekly games and men’s and women’s leagues. Its pickleball offering also includes weekly leagues, open play and social events.
These programs matter because communities rarely form through amenities alone.
Eight courts and 18 holes create capacity. Recurring events create relationships.
